GEICO Associates Donate $1.1M to United Way of Central Georgia

Staff Report From Middle Georgia CEO

Friday, April 15th, 2016

Local residents, community leaders and GEICO associates attended an appreciation event at the GEICO office in Macon as the company and its associates were named United Way of Central Georgia’s top contributor for the 12th year in a row, pledging $1,101,195 during the 2015 United Way campaign.

GEICO is the first company campaign in Central Georgia to ever top the $1.1 million mark.  GEICO associates raised $900,005 and their corporate gift was $201,190.
